Searching for Matches

The Search Bar allows you to quickly find a specific match.

You can search primarily using information such as:

  • Match Name
  • Opponent
  • Tags

This becomes increasingly useful as your archive grows across a season.

Filtering and Sorting Matches

Click Filter to open the Filter Matches popup.

Filter Matches popup

Sort By

Matches can be sorted by different criteria, including:

  • Date
  • Number of Goals
  • Outcome
  • Goal Difference
  • Goals Scored
  • Goals Against
  • Opponent
  • League

This changes the order in which matching games are displayed.

Display Filters

Display Filters determine which matches are included in the archive view.

You can filter by:

  • Start Date
  • End Date
  • Venue — Home or Away
  • Outcome
  • League
  • Match Type
  • Opponent
  • Tags

Outcome filtering can distinguish between results such as Win, Loss, Win OT and Loss OT.

Match Type can be used to separate different types of games, such as regular competition matches and friendlies.

Match Cards

Every match is represented by a card containing the main information about the game.

A Match Card can display:

  • Match Name
  • Score
  • Date
  • Venue
  • Opponent
  • League
  • Type
  • Up to three Tags

Each card also provides actions for opening or managing the match.

The arrow button opens Match Detail.

The three-dot menu gives you access to additional options.

From there, you can open the Board to return to Match Tracking or open the match settings.

Editing a Match

Opening the match settings gives you access to the Edit Match popup.

Here, you can update match information such as:

  • Match Name
  • Opponent
  • Date
  • Venue
  • Match Type
  • Tags
  • League

You can also manage Opposition formations and assign Opposition players to the relevant lineups.

This is useful when the Opposition setup changes or when you need to complete their lineup information before or during the match.
